Biography

German Khanbusinessman with roots in the USSR

German Khan is a Ukrainian-born Israeli-Russian billionaire who co-founded Alfa Group Consortium alongside Mikhail Fridman — one of Russia's most powerful conglomerates spanning banking (Alfa-Bank), oil (TNK-BP), telecoms (Vimpelcom), and retail. He holds Israeli citizenship and relocated following Russia's invasion of Ukraine.

Russian Connection

Tracing the rootsKyiv (Ukraine)

Born in Kyiv in 1961 and educated as an engineer, Khan joined Fridman in building Alfa Group from a Soviet cooperative into a diversified empire. The Kyiv-born Jewish background he shares with Fridman and Aven is a defining thread of Alfa Group's founding generation — post-Soviet entrepreneurs shaped by the Jewish intellectual culture of the Russian Empire's Ukrainian heartland.
